A must do if in Sorrento/Amalfi coastarea - Found this by pure chance whilst on a train to Pompeii. On the train route display on board it showed a cable car at Castellammare di Stabia, so decided to investigate a bit further. Took a train from Sorrento and got off at Castellammare di Stabia. The cable car entrance is in the main station and tickets can be bought inside the station. Its an 8 minute trip up and costs 9.5 euros for an adult return. There are a couple of restaurants up the top that are comparable in price to what you can get anywhere else in the Amalfi region. The views of the bay of Naples from the top are the best you could hope for. There are walking routes around the area and it is also a place where paragliders and hang gliders can launch. It is a bit cooler than sea level, and the trees provide extra shade if you are a bit too hot. The day we went it wasn't too busy and fairly cool but I can imagine it may get a lot busier in warmer months.
